Pluralsight, Inc., the globally renowned enterprise technology skills platform and solutions provider, has announced an expansion of the company’s skill development initiative for Microsoft Azure.

This skill coverage expansion includes the introduction of five new Role IQs, 22 new Skill IQs and 98 courses that map to the new Role IQs, which are designed to help customers rapidly index their teams’ skills on Azure and help close resulting gaps.

Expansion of Pluralsight Skills for Azure

The expansion of Pluralsight Skills for Azure will deliver newly developed Role IQs, Skill IQs and courses that are specially designed to provide a skill development path for many of the most in-demand skills in tech.

These new Role IQs, which are specifically tailored to key Azure roles and Microsoft’s official role-based certifications, include:

  • Microsoft Azure AI Engineer
  • Microsoft Azure Data Engineer
  • Microsoft Azure Data Scientist
  • Microsoft Azure DevOps Engineer
  • Microsoft Azure Security Engineer
